St. John's Methodist Church
1325-1329 Brady St.
Davenport, Iowa
St. John's Methodist Church is located in Scott County, Iowa certified as a historic location on Thursday July 07, 1983. This location is a protected historic place because of historical significance relating to Religion, more specifically a Religious Structure, Church Related Residence. St. John's Methodist Church was nominated by as a historic location by State Government based on Event, Architecture/Engineering and its significance in Architecture, Religion.
St. John's Methodist Church Information
Other Name: Davenport MRAOwnership Type: Private
Type of Resource: Building
Historically Significant Years Associated With This Location: 1903
Level of Governmental Significance: Local
Architect, builder, or engineer: Claussen,F.G.; Burrows,Parke
